    One common take on burnout in adolescents that I disagree with is the notion that burnout results solely from academic pressure and a lack of personal discipline. This perspective ignores broader systemic issues like unrealistic societal expectations, inadequate mental health support, and the pressure to succeed at a young age. By reducing burnout to a matter of individual choices or study habits, this view neglects the complex interplay of societal, familial, and personal factors. A holistic understanding of adolescent burnout requires acknowledging these broader pressures and addressing the underlying causes, rather than just attributing it to individual shortcomings or overachieving
